# Break-Glass: Catalog Cache Invalidation

Scope: the Pinrow product catalog at Veldstone Retail. If stale prices persist after a purge and the Hollowmere invalidation queue is wedged, use break-glass to flush the edge tier directly. Contractors: get verbal sign-off from the catalog lead first. Steps: open the Hollowmere admin shell, select emergency-flush, confirm the tenant, and run it once — repeated flushes thrash the origin. Access is logged and expires after 20 minutes. Unseal the admin shell with the passphrase below.

recovery phrase for kahop-tajog: istix-casvan

- [ ] Step 7: Archive cold storage buckets (Glacierline tier). Confirm both ceremony witnesses are present, verify bucket manifests match the Oxbow ledger, then seal the archive key shares. Plugin authors may observe but not handle shares. Once sealed, the archive index itself is encrypted and can only be reopened with the passphrase below.

vault phrase of badup-hahig = tamael-aldael-kelmir-istael-fenok-istwyn-tamius-jorath-oliion

Subject: Marketing budget trim — heads up

Hi all, quick note before Friday's sync: we're trimming the Brightloom campaign spend by 18% for next quarter. Nothing dramatic — mostly paused display ads and the Kelverton event sponsorship. Our incoming director should have full context before day one, so I'm sharing the rationale below.

board note of bawep-tajef: Queniusek Systems plans to raise the Quenvan list price by 53.1 percent in March. The pricing group signed off on a budget of $176.4 million for Project Drueth. The renewal with Casionix Partners closes at $142.5 million a year, 8.3 percent below the last contract. Project Fraax slips by six weeks because of the tooling delay.

The Timetaber solver takes a school's constraints — rooms, teachers, no-clash rules — and returns a draft schedule in about 20 seconds. If a customer reports a hung job, check `GET /jobs/{id}/status` first. That endpoint lives on our internal Gradeworks service, so you'll need its key, pasted below.

gateway credential: kto3_qfe

## DedupeDaemon — Onboarding

DedupeDaemon collapses duplicate on-call alerts before they hit the pager queue. Runs on the Fenwick cluster, one replica per region. Config lives in `dedupe.toml`; fingerprint window defaults to 90s. Restart is safe; state is rebuilt from the alert bus. It authenticates to the alert bus with the key below.

app token of tadug-yahag = vxb3-949